    Optimal Pruning Times

    While many tree care tasks can be performed year-round, it's important to understand that pruning should typically be done during certain seasons for best results. Spring pruning, for instance, is ideal for many trees as it promotes robust growth during the warmer months. It's a time when trees are budding and their sap is rising, so they recover from cuts quicker. On the contrary, fall trimming can aid trees in preparing for the dormant winter season, reducing the chance of damage from harsh weather conditions. However, always consider the type of tree before deciding when to prune. Some species, such as flowering trees, may have unique requirements. Ultimately, understanding the best pruning seasons enhances your tree's health and longevity.

    Trimming Techniques Unveiled

    Having covered the best times for pruning, let's explore how to trim your trees effectively. The practice of shaping trees isn't solely cosmetic; it's essential for tree wellness and durability. Make sure to use well-maintained, sharp tools to minimize potential injury to the tree and remember that precision is key.

    Start by identifying diseased or dead branches. These need to be your first priorities as they might harm the rest of the tree. Then, evaluate the tree's structure and symmetry. Try to avoid removing large branches; instead, focus on smaller branches that can be trimmed without compromising the tree's general health. Lastly, never cut too close to the tree stem as it could cause decay. Remember, the goal is vigorous, properly formed trees.

    Addressing Tree Disease Problems

    Similar to how pests can endanger the health of your trees, various diseases also create substantial hazards. Proper disease identification is vital in establishing the best treatment approach. Widespread diseases encompass root rot, leaf spots, and fire blight, each exhibiting unique symptoms. Upon seeing abnormal coloring, abnormal formations, or abrupt drooping, it's necessary to consult a professional for a comprehensive diagnosis. When you've determined the disease, you should explore treatment options. Depending on the disease type, these may involve pruning, administering targeted remedies, or in extreme cases, tree removal. Don't forget, early detection and swift action are crucial to managing tree diseases successfully and safeguarding the health of your trees.     The Essential Nature of Proper Fertilization: Fertilizing Your Trees

    To guarantee the health and longevity of your trees, providing them with proper nutrition is essential. Like all living things, trees require a well-rounded nutrition to flourish. They require a blend of primary and trace elements, which they typically absorb from the soil. However, urban soil often lacks these essential nutrients, making fertilization a vital part of arboreal care.

    Master tree nutritional needs and grasp the correct fertilizing methods. Use a slow-release fertilizer to steadily provide nutrients to the tree's roots, encouraging better growth. The schedule is critical; generally, early spring and fall are the ideal times to fertilize trees. Don't forget, wrong fertilizing can result in nutrient damage or shortage. Therefore, strive for balance in your tree's feeding program.

    The Impact of Weather: Adapting Tree Care to Sarasota's Climate

    Along with proper nutrition, it's vital to understand Sarasota's unique climate and adjust your tree care practices accordingly. Year-round high humidity can have substantial effects on trees, frequently leading to fungal issues. Inspect your trees regularly for illness indicators, especially following periods of intense rain.

    The seasonal storms in Sarasota play a crucial role in tree care and upkeep. Between the heavy summer rains and rare winter frost, these conditions can stress trees, leaving them at higher risk of damage and disease. It's crucial to trim away weak branches and verify trees are stable prior to the storm season.

    Hiring a Tree Specialist: Essential Factors to Consider in Sarasota

    Not sure how to choose a trustworthy tree specialist in Sarasota? It's vital to evaluate certification standards and service reviews. Qualified experts have received thorough training and comply with industry standards, making sure they're qualified to address your tree care needs efficiently. Check whether prospective experts have ISA (International Society of Arboriculture) or TCIA (Tree Care Industry Association) certifications. These serve as esteemed credentials in the field. Moreover, don't overlook service reviews. Client feedback offers perspective on the specialist's reliability.
